Requirements
• 10+ years in security, with a focus on DevSecOps and security design reviews • Hands-on experience with secure coding, OWASP Top 10, threat modeling, and SDLC integration • Experience with GitHub/GitLab, CI/CD, IaC, and containerized environments • Experience deploying and working with SAST tooling (e.g. Semgrep, Snyk) • Experience developing in Python and Go. • Track record of balancing pragmatism and security rigor in a fast-paced setting • Strong communication skills • Understanding of AI security fundamentals and how application security and AI security intersect • Experience securing cloud infrastructure • Participation in bug bounty programs and managing security disclosure • Familiarity with the BSIMM framework • Experience in cloud security including identity and access management and cloud-native services. • We value diversity and are committed to equal employment opportunity regardless of sex, race, religion, ethnicity, nationality, disability, age, sexual orientation or gender identity. Responsibilities
• Architect and integrate security tooling directly into CI/CD pipelines to automate the detection and prevention of vulnerabilities, ensuring "shift-left" security at scale. • Lead threat modeling and secure design reviews for web applications, APIs, and cloud services. • Oversee the end-to-end product vulnerability lifecycle, from issue triage, prioritization, remediation support, with clear risk communication. • Drive secure coding standards, develop playbooks, and provide hand-on training and mentorship to instill a security-first mindset across the organization. • Design and scale secure development practices by collaborating cross-functionally with engineering teams throughout the entire software lifecycle. • Engage with customers during security reviews
